2014-01-07 2 views
0

현재 데이터가 없을 때 차트를 숨길 수있는 보고서에 조건부 서식을 적용하려고합니다. like hereSSRS 데이터를 기반으로 한 차트 가시성

내가 가지고있는 문제는 여러 개의 차트가 하나의 데이터 세트로 만들어지고 필터가 차트 속성 내에서 콘텐츠를 설정하는 데 적용된다는 것입니다. 경우에 따라 이러한 필터로 인해 차트에 데이터가 없어지게됩니다 (예 : 매장에서 해당 제품을 재고하지 않은 경우).

나는 위에서 언급 한 방법을 시도했지만, 내 데이터 세트에는 저장소 (특정 제품 라인이 아님)에 대한 데이터가 있으므로 차트를 숨기지 않습니다.

도움을 주시면 감사하겠습니다.

답변

0

행 또는 전체 테이블을 필터링하려고합니까? 행의 경우 행 가시성 식을 설정할 수 있습니다. 예를 들어 IIF (Fields! hideme.Value는 nothing, true, false) 과 같거나 그룹 속성에서 행 필터를 설정하여 동일한 작업을 수행 할 수 있습니다. 널 (null) 일 때 숨기려고하는 널 (NULL) 열. 가시성, 표/열/행 등을 설정할 때 어디에서나 작동하는 방법입니다. 도움이 되길 바랍니다.

+0

실제로 차트 전체를 숨기려고합니다. 내 보고서에는 동일한 데이터 세트에서 구동되는 차트 인스턴스가 2 개 있습니다. 첫 번째 차트에는 전체 국가 그림이 표시되고 두 번째 차트에는 특정 저장소 (보고서가있는 위치)의 데이터 만 표시되도록 필터가 적용됩니다. 때로는 보고서 저장 버전이 차트에 적용된 필터의 결과로 데이터를 가져 오지 않는 위치에서 발생합니다. 이 상황에서 차트 제목과 '표시 할 데이터 없음'메시지 대신 차트를 숨기려고합니다. – Dan